The Feeding Guidelines per day below is approximated:
For an average size cat 9lb. to 13lb. (4kg to 6kg), feed 1 to 1.5 6oz (170g) cans per day. This feeding recommendation is a guide only. Remember that a cat’s nutritional requirements vary according to activity, individual metabolism, health, and environment. If your cat is overweight, please feed less. If it is under weight, please feed more.
*For Senior and less active cats feed 3/4 of the amounts shown.
*Kittens require up to 3 times the amounts shown, please consult your veterinarian for advice.

TRANSITION INSTRUCTIONS
It takes time to transition your pet to a new food without having digestive upset. Over the course of one to two weeks, you should gradually switch from the old food to the new. Start with a 75% old to 25% new mix, then 50:50, and finally 25:75, until you have switched to Kiwi Kitchens food entirely.
